Factors Affecting Cost

Installing a handicap-accessible bathtub in Shelton, WA, involves considerations related to materials, size, labor, permits, and optional features. Understanding these factors can help in planning and comparing project options for accessible bathing solutions.

  • Materials: Options include acrylic, fiberglass, or composite materials, each offering different durability and ease of maintenance.
  • Size and Scope: Typical installations accommodate standard or custom dimensions to ensure accessibility and fit within existing bathroom layouts.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ation may involve modifications to plumbing, flooring, or walls, affecting the overall complexity and duration of the project.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Shelton, WA, may require permits for bathtub modifications, especially for structural or plumbing changes.
  • Extras: Additional features such as grab bars, non-slip surfaces, or built-in seating can enhance accessibility but may impact overall costs and installation considerations.

Project Size Considerations

Scope/Size Typical Range
Standard Walk-In Tub $3,500 - $8,000
Modified Bathtub with Grab Bars $2,000 - $5,000
Full Accessibility Conversion $10,000 - $20,000
Additional Features (e.g., seats, hand showers) $500 - $2,500
Permitting and Design $500 - $2,000

In Shelton, WA, project costs for handicap bathtub installations can vary based on the scope and specific features selected.
